Dear Sunflower Families,

As you know, all public schools in the state of Kansas participate in state testing each year. This is often referred to as KAP testing (Kansas Assessment Program). At the elementary school level, all 3rd and 4th grade students complete an assessment in English Language Arts (ELA) and Math. These assessments are completed each spring (April or May).

Recently, our school district received the results of these assessments from the 2024-25 school year. I am pleased to report that KAP scores for Sunflower from the 2024-25 school year showed significant improvements over the previous school years in both grade levels.

For the 2024-25 ELA KAP test, the number of 3rd grade Sunflower students scoring in the top two ranges (proficient and advanced ranges) increased by 23 percentage points over the previous year. In addition, the number of 4th grade Sunflower students scoring in the top two ranges of the 2024-25 ELA KAP test increased by 14 percentage points.

For the 2024-25 Math KAP test, the number of 3rd grade Sunflower students scoring in the top two ranges (proficient and advanced ranges) increased by 5 percentage points over the previous school year. The number of 4th grade Sunflower students scoring in the top two ranges of the 2024-25 Math KAP test increased by 10 percentage points.

All members of the school community contribute to the success and academic growth of our students. We should all take pride in the impressive and significant academic gains that our school has made. Strong test scores are a product of enthusiastic students, supportive families and dedicated educators partnering together each day. We look forward to continued academic growth of our students and productive partnership with our families at Sunflower.

In the upcoming weeks, we will have access to information that allows us to see how our KAP test results compared with other schools in the State of Kansas. I will be happy to share that information with you at that time.

Dear Sunflower Families,

Our students engaged in a really fun learning experience at Sunflower today. The Mobile Dairy made a visit to our campus this morning and provided three separate 30-minute assemblies for us to enjoy. In total, all students (grades Pre-K through 4th grade) were able to attend one of the assemblies today. As you might expect, the level of engagement was very high. Our students attentively listened to the presentation, asked really good questions, and learned a lot.

A special thanks to Kari Hamilton for presenting and educating our students today. She provided a great deal of interesting information about working on a dairy farm, ensuring the health of her cows, the processes of getting milk from farm to store as well as the nutritional value of drinking milk regularly.

I'll also take this opportunity to offer a word of thanks to Hazel-Grace for her very important part of the learning experience today.
